In 1868, the Spanish Revolution of 1868, also known as the Glorious Revolution, forced Isabella II, the last queen regnant of Spain, to abdicate the throne. The revolution was led by a coalition of military officers and liberals who were opposed to the authoritarian rule of Isabella and her ministers.
